Planting Calendar for Nemesia

Frost tolerance for nemesia: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ost.

It's probably not a good idea to plant nemesia until after the last frost when the weather gets warmer because they require warm weather.

The earliest that you can plant nemesia in Carlsbad is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ant nemesia and expect a good harvest is probably September. If you wait any later than that and your nemesia may not have a chance to grow to maturity. Starting your nemesia indoors is a great way to get them started a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

In Carlsbad the average date of last frost happens on January 31. You can expect an average low temperature of 30°F in the coldest months of winter.

Keep in mind that the actual date of last frost is just an average because it is based on the USDA zone info for Carlsbad and it will vary from year to year. Since half of the time in Carlsbad last frost occurs after January 31 be ready to protect your nemesia in the event of one of those late frosts.
